January 9, 201610 yr Ladies & Gentlemen: I'm returning to Harpoon. Purchased Harpoon Ultimate Edition from Matrix. Had DVD shipped because of poor internet connection. Just installed on a new week old Windows 10 machine. Installation went find and the game is running. Checked the version # and it was 2009.050. So I conclude that I must run updates from Matrix website. Do I need to run the 10/10/13 V2009.097 update then run the 1/4/16 V2015.027 update? Or can I run just the 1/4/16 update (does it include the 10/10/13 update)?
January 9, 201610 yr You can skip right to the 2015.027 update, it is comprehensive (includes all of the previous updates). Great to have you back!

January 10, 20206 yr 7 hours ago, Luka said: Hi Tony Here the screen shot I see and then Harpoon shuts down... Luka, this often means you have a mismatch between scenario and database but could also mean that you are using a database that is not compatible with the version of the game you are using. The next helpful troubleshooting step is posting your ge.log file from the game directory. Alternatively tell us what version of the game you are using, which database (including version), and which scenario.

December 10, 20205 yr I'll take RONALD REAGAN 2016-12.scq as an example. Here is what I did... Searched HarpGamer for Ronald Reagan and saw an entry that looked promising. Reagan against China, December 2016-early 2017. Hypothetical/Historical Scenario. - WestPac - HarpGamer That entry says you need the HCDB2 database. Looking in the downloads area, I see that at HCDB2-170909 (1980-2025) - Databases - HarpGamer Just because HCDB2 is the database for this one example doesn't not mean HCDB2 is the database for all of them. An alternate approach for new enough scenarios is to open the scenario file with Notepad and near the beginning will be the database name like "HCDB-150621"
